Preparing for your move in Southwark
A practical checklist for customers
Good preparation makes any removal van job easier. In Southwark, where access can be limited and parking can be tight, a little planning goes a long way. You do not need to do everything yourself, but being organised will help the move run more efficiently.
Here is a simple preparation checklist:
- Sort items into what is moving, storing, donating, or discarding
- Label boxes by room and priority
- Keep important documents, valuables, and essentials separate
- Measure large furniture and doorways if you are unsure about access
- Check lift bookings, entry codes, or concierge requirements
- Reserve parking where needed, if your building or local rules require it
- Disconnect appliances in advance if it is safe to do so
- Pack a first-night bag with basics such as chargers, medication, and toiletries
For office moves, it also helps to label desks, devices, cables, and files clearly so that the new workspace can be set up quickly. For families, keeping children’s essentials easy to reach can make the first evening in a new home much less stressful. Small steps before moving day can save a lot of time later.
Furniture and item preparation tips
If you are moving larger items, you can make things easier by:
- Emptying drawers and cabinets
- Removing loose shelves or detachable parts
- Securing doors and lids
- Wrapping fragile surfaces where needed
- Keeping screws and fittings in labelled bags
These steps help the team load items more efficiently and reduce the chance of damage during the journey.
Pricing factors for removal van services
Customers naturally want to understand what affects the cost of a removal van in Southwark. Exact prices depend on the details of the move, so it is better to focus on the factors that usually shape the quote. That way you can compare services fairly and choose the right option for your situation.
Typical pricing factors include:
- The size of the van needed
- How much furniture and boxed items are being moved
- Distance between the pickup and delivery points
- Number of loading and unloading hours required
- Whether stairs, lifts, or difficult access are involved
- Whether the move includes packing, dismantling, or reassembly support
- Timing, such as weekend, evening, or short-notice moves
In Southwark, access challenges can affect the time needed for a move. A short journey can still require careful planning if parking is limited or the property is hard to reach. That is one reason local customers value clear quotes based on real moving conditions rather than vague estimates.
Always provide accurate details when requesting a quote. If you understate the amount of furniture or forget to mention stairs, the schedule may be too tight. If you explain everything properly from the beginning, you are more likely to receive a quote that reflects the actual job.
It is also worth asking what support is included, so you can compare service like for like. Some customers only need transport. Others need a more hands-on move with loading help and careful item placement. The best option is the one that fits the move, not just the van.

Residential moves: flats, homes, and shared properties
Many removal van jobs in Southwark involve residential moves. The borough has a lot of flats, apartments, split-level homes, and shared accommodation, so it is common for customers to need help with stairs, compact entrances, and furniture that is difficult to carry alone. A removal van service is especially useful when you are moving out of a property with limited storage space or moving into a place where the layout requires careful positioning of furniture.
For flat moves, a few extra details can make a big difference. Can the van stop close enough to the entrance? Is there a lift, and does it need to be reserved? Are there house rules for moving hours? Is there a concierge or building manager who needs to be informed? These may sound small, but they are exactly the things that affect whether the move feels smooth or stressful.
For family homes, the challenge is often volume. Sofas, beds, wardrobes, dining tables, and boxes can quickly fill a van. That is where good planning matters. A team can assess whether one trip is enough or whether your move will be better handled by a larger vehicle or a staged approach. Either way, the goal is the same: keep your belongings secure and make the transition to your new home easier.
If you are moving from a shared property, timing may also be important. You may need to move around work schedules, key handover times, or other tenants using the same entrance. A local removal van company that understands Southwark’s housing mix can help you plan around that.

Helpful points for office moves
- Label equipment clearly by department or room.
- Back up digital files before moving any devices.
- Plan who will receive items at the new premises.
- Check lift and loading access at both locations.
- Keep cables and accessories together to avoid delays later.
